        Five spider species from the genus Pholcus Walckenaer, 1805, namely Pholcus geogeum sp. nov., Pholcus hongseong sp. nov., Pholcus gochang sp. nov., Pholcus jeocheon sp. nov., and Pholcus yongin sp. nov., are newly described from Korea. These five new species, which belong to the phungiformes group within the genus, can be distinguished from their congeners by the shape and structure of the genital organs of both males and females. They are found on rock walls and at cave entrances in mountainous and hilly mixed forests. This study provides diagnoses, detailed descriptions, and taxonomic photographs of the newly described species.

        A new spider species of the genus Pholcus Walckenaer, 1805, Pholcus osaek sp. nov., in the family Pholcidae C.L. Koch, 1850, is described from Korea. This new species belongs to phungiformes-group in the genus. It can be distinguished from its congeners by the shape and structure of genital organs of both males and females. It is found on and between rock walls in mountainous mixed forests. Additionally, the taxonomic status of Pholcus uksuensis Kim & Ye, 2014 is revalidated, re-diagnosed, and redescribed based on specimens collected from the type locality. Considering differences mentioned in the diagnosis through revalidation, P. uksuensis is regarded as a distinct species. Therefore, it should be removed from the synonymy of P. woongil Huber, 2011.

        The present study describes Philodromus rufus Walckenaer, 1826 with detailed descriptions, taxonomic photographs, distribution map, and proposition of a new synonym. Due to morphological similarity between P. pseudoexilis Paik, 1979 and P. rufus, taxonomic identity of P. pseudoexilis has been doubtful to date. A detailed bibliographic study of types of P. pseudoexilis between P. rufus and examination of specimens from the type locality of P. pseudoexilis with specimens of P. rufus collected across the country showed that P. rufus has all diagnostic characters found in types of P. pseudoexilis. Therefore, P. pseudoexilis Paik, 1979 should be regarded as a new synonym of Philodromus rufus Walckenaer, 1826.

        The present study describes Philodromus paiki sp. nov., which was previously misidentified as P. fuscomarginatus (De Geer, 1778), P. poecilus (Thorell, 1872), and P. spinitarsis Simon, 1895 in Korea, as a new species with diagnosis, detailed descriptions, and taxonomic photographs. Additionally, P. spinitarsis is also described to correct previous misidentifications of Korean records of the species.

        A male Spheropistha melanosoma Yaginuma, 1957 from Korea in the family Theridiidae Sundevall, 1833 is described with measurements and morphological photos of the diagnostic characteristics. This species was collected with a sweep net around arable lands in a mountainous mixed forest during the investigation of spider fauna on Ulleungdo Island in 2019.

        Two linyphiid spiders, Saitonia kawaguchikonis Saito & Ono, 2001 and Asthenargus niphonius Saito & Ono, 2001 were confirmed from Korea for the first time. Males of S. kawaguchikonis and a female of A. niphonius were collected with pitfall traps in a leaf litter of mixed forests in three National Parks (Hallyeohaesang National Park, Mt. Naejangsan, and Mt. Sobaeksan) during the seasonal surveys for the spider fauna in mountainous terrain from 2018 to 2020. These two species were formerly known from China and Japan, or only from Japan, respectively. The present study describes these two species with measurements, morphological illustrations, and a distribution map. This report adds the genus Asthenargus Simon & Fage, 1922 from Korea to the Korean spider fauna for the first time.

        전해질막을 사용하는 알칼라인 연료전지는 최근 들어서 시스템 구성이 비슷하고 전해질막의 종류만 다른 기존의 양이온 교환막 연료전지를 대체할 수 있을 것으로 기대를 모으고 있다. 특히, 알칼라인 연료전지에서는 비백금계 저가 촉매가 사용 가능하여 많은 연구들이 진행되고 있다. 본 연구에서는 이러한 알칼라인 연료전지 시스템에 적용하기 위한 고성능, 고내 구성 음이온 교환막을 제조하기 위하여, 두 종류의 다공성 지지체인 폴리벤조옥사졸 지지체와 폴리에틸렌 지지체에 Fumion FAA 이오노머를 함침시켜, 기존의 Fumion 시리즈의 막보다 우수한 기계적 강도를 가지면서 높은 이온전도도를 유지할 수 있는 함침막을 제조하고자 하였다. 이를 통하여 최종적으로 지지체-함침막이 성공적으로 제조되었고, 이온 전도도와 기계적 특성이 지지체의 성질에 따라 서로 다른 결과를 보여 주었다. PE 지지체에 Fumion 이오노머를 함침시킨 함침막에서는 우수 한 기계적 특성이 얻어졌지만, 이온전도도는 감소하였으며 특히 높은 온도에서 성능감소가 더욱 증가하였다. 반면에 PBO 지 지체에 Fumion 이오노머를 함침 시킨 경우에는 PBO의 높은 염기성으로 인하여 함침 후에 높은 이온 전도도를 보였지만, Fumion-PE막에 비하여 상대적으로 낮은 기계적 특성을 나타내었다. 결과적으로 지지체-함침막 제조 시 알칼라인 연료전지의 운전조건에 따라 지지체의 특성을 충분히 고려하여 연구를 진행할 필요가 있다는 결론을 얻었다.

        Pressure retarded osmosis (PRO) has been considered as promising technology utilizing blue energy1. However, polymeric thin film composite membranes are insufficient to meet requirements: robustness, high permeability and selectivity. In this study, new type of membrane has been developed consisting of thermally rearranged poly(benzoxazole) (TR-PBO) electrospun membrane as a support layer and ultra-thin polyamide (PA) active layer2. Because TR-PBO has high mechanical strength, it can be used at high hydraulic pressure. This means that high concentrated solution can be used as a draw and, subsequently, high power density can be obtained. The characteristics and performance of the membrane will be presented.

        Membrane distillation (MD) has been researched as one of the promising seawater desalination processes, because of its advantages such as (1) high energy efficiency, high water flux and less fouling sensitivity. [1] Herein, thermally rearranged (TR) polymer membranes are introduced for MD application. The TR membranes were investigated by SEM, contact angle, CFP and LEPw. TR membranes showed a great MD performance with high water flux and long-term stability.
